What is the electronic signature lawfulness for government in European Union
The electronic signature lawfulness for government in the European Union is governed by the eIDAS Regulation, which establishes a legal framework for electronic signatures, ensuring their validity and acceptance across member states. This regulation recognizes electronic signatures as equivalent to handwritten signatures, provided they meet specific requirements. The lawfulness of electronic signatures is essential for government transactions, enabling efficient and secure processes while maintaining compliance with legal standards.

Legal use of the electronic signature lawfulness for government in European Union
The legal use of electronic signatures in government transactions within the European Union is supported by the eIDAS Regulation, which outlines the conditions under which electronic signatures are considered valid. This includes the requirement for signatures to be created using secure methods and the necessity for signers to be identifiable. Government agencies can confidently accept electronic signatures as legally binding, thus enhancing the efficiency of public administration processes.
Security & Compliance Guidelines
When utilizing electronic signatures for government purposes, it is crucial to adhere to security and compliance guidelines to protect sensitive information. Key considerations include:
- Ensure the electronic signature solution complies with eIDAS and other relevant regulations.
- Implement strong authentication methods to verify the identity of signers.
- Utilize encryption to safeguard documents during transmission and storage.
- Regularly audit and update security measures to address emerging threats.
